KGIRS Interim Management Committee Submits Report To Gov. Bello, Makes Far Reaching Recommendations

The Interim Management Committee of Kogi State Internal Revenue Service headed by Hon. Mukadam Asiwaju Asiru Idris has submitted the report of their activities to the Gov. Yahaya Bello.

The report which was submitted yesterday at the Government House Lokoja, made some far reaching recommendations as solutions towards improving the corporate governance of the service.

Similarly, the Committee recommended sound internal control measures that will lead to improve revenue generation for the State.

Still contained in the report of the IMC was the improve Welfare of staff and capcity building that would meet the contemporary method of revenue generation.

Recalled that the Gov. Yahaya Bello, had on 22 September, 2020 suspended the management staff of the Kogi State Internal Revenue Service.
The State Government’s suspension of the former management of the KGIRS was also predicated on violation of corporate governance in the service.

The Commissioner for Finance, Mukadam Idris was appointed to head the six man Interim Management Committee made to oversee the day to day activities of the agency for three months which ended with the submission of the report.

Other members of the IMC include: The State Attorney General and Commissioner of Justice, Mr. Ibrahim Sani Mohammed (SAN); the Auditor General of the State, Alhaji Yakubu Okala; and the Auditor General for Local Governments, Alh. Usman Ododo, while the Accountant General of the State, Alhaji Momoh Jibrin is to serve as the secretary.

Receiving the report, Gov. Yahaya Bello promised to look into the recommendations of the committee with a view to reposition the KGIRS.
